Most Notable Case :
March 1994
U.S. v. Tilethia Brown Superior Ct; DC

Criminal/Second degree theft, etc

This was our first trial after being licensed to practice law for three (3) months. Our client Ms. Tilethia Brown who was employed at DOT, was accused of stealing a co-workers money from her purse while others were at lunch. She asserted her innocence and the case was well investigated and we went to trial. After a one (1) day trial, Ms. Brown was found not guilty and acquitted of all charges.
